The are flowering plants that like mild weather and are seen mostly throughout Mexico. They can’t be raised outdoors in Northern climates, and are therefore raised inside greenhouses. In areas outside its natural environment it is commonly grown as an indoor plant where it prefers good morning sun then shade in the hotter part of the day.
